我在TensorFlow中使用MDNet跟踪器,但是无法恢复.npy格式的已保存参数文件
using Microsoft.OpenApi.Models;
但是,收到以下错误消息:
# restore from model
restore_path = np.load(r"/home/ammar/Bureau/BSB/objectDetector/MDNet/TensorFlow/Tensorflow-
MDNet2/PyMDNet/models/init.npy", encoding='latin1', allow_pickle=True)
print(restore_path.shape)
saver.restore(sess, restore_path)
# run mdnet
mdnet_run(sess, model, train_data.data[seq].gts[0], train_data.data[seq].frames, config, display)
def get_params():
parser = argparse.ArgumentParser()
parser.add_argument('--no_display', action='store_true', help='disable display')
parser.add_argument('--dataset', choices=['otb', 'vot2013', 'vot2014', 'vot2015'],
help='choose pretrained dataset: [otb/vot2013/vot2014/vot2015]')
parser.add_argument('--seq', default=None, help='specify the sequence name')
# parser.add_argument('--load_path', default=None, help='initial model path')
return parser.parse_args()
if __name__ == '__main__':
params = get_params()
tracking(params.dataset, params.seq, display=(not params.no_display))
我正在使用Python版本= 3.6,TensorFlow = 1.10和Numpy = 1.18: 无法在python 3中加载.npy文件,或者在加载文件的方式上有问题吗?